Maple Sugar Time again! Learn about the maple sugaring tradition in North America, from its origins among Native Americans to its popularity among family farms. A great history supplement for your modern day Sugarhouse visits or maple sugaring educational materials.

Includes Two-Page Activity set with additional Word Search Puzzle that reinforces key vocabulary from the Activity Set.
